On November 13, Minister of Economics Viktors Valainis met with the Czech Ambassador to Latvia, Martin Vítek. During the visit, representatives of both countries discussed bilateral cooperation and its prospects, including collaboration in the machinery and space sectors.

During the talks, both sides acknowledged the significant potential to further develop mutual cooperation across various industries.

“Latvia and the Czech Republic have implemented several successful investment and cooperation projects in sectors such as machinery, energy, and mobility. Looking ahead, we recognize the need for close collaboration to promote a more balanced and mutually beneficial economic partnership. Latvia and the Czech Republic have the opportunity to build a strong bilateral partnership characterized by stable trade and investment flows,” emphasized Minister of Economics Viktors Valainis.

During the discussions, V. Valainis encouraged Czech companies to consider strategic cooperation opportunities in various sectors, such as machinery, research, and space, where there is substantial potential for mutually beneficial collaboration.

The Minister also positively noted the participation of Czech companies in the “Tech Industry” event and the interest of Škoda Group in expanding its business in Latvia. Such events highlight broader cooperation opportunities between the two countries in machinery and related sectors.

Additionally, the representatives of both countries agreed to organize a joint meeting of business and senior government delegations next year to further develop bilateral cooperation. Regular delegation visits and sectoral meetings confirm a strong commitment to continue deepening and expanding economic collaboration between Latvia and the Czech Republic.
